Closer Look: RideTech AirPod System

Slide Show
In the past, installing an air suspension system on your custom ride required hooking up a separate compressor system. Hooking up a compressor system meant running cables and air lines all over the place and then trying to hide them. And that meant lots of time, hassles, and headaches for the installer.
Fortunately, the experts at RideTech have come up with a better way--the RideTech AirPod System. The revolutionary AirPod System makes compressor installation a simple plug-in deal, shortens installation time from 10-15 hours to roughly an hour, and turns those headaches into happiness.
AirPod Advantage One: Simple Installation
The RideTech AirPod System comes pre-assembled with all the major components needed to get your air suspension up and running. The compressor, aluminum air tank, solenoids, pressure sensors, and ECU control module are all pre-mounted, pre-plumbed, and pre-wired within the main unit. You need to make just three wiring connections and four plumbing connections--up to 13 fewer connections than typical compressor system hookups.
The AirPod's pre-assembled main unit mounts inside your trunk with self-tapping screws or bolts and serves as the brains of the system. Simply connect your four air lines to the main unit's push-on style air line fittings and secure the lines with zip ties. Then, plug in the included power harness to the back of the main unit and make three simple connections: red power wire to battery, black ground wire to chassis point, and yellow switched wire to ignition. The final step is to plug the display/control unit into the back of the main unit.
AirPod Advantage Two: Easy Operation
The AirPod System features your choice of RideTech's RidePro e2(r) or LevelPro control systems. Both offer three programmable presets and manual settings for accurate control of your air suspension. The AirPod System with the LevelPro options includes four ride height sensors that allow the computer to actually measure the height of the vehicle and make air pressure adjustments to maintain accurate ride height presets under changing load conditions. These height sensors easily plug into the supplied wiring harness to give you the most advanced air suspension system available today.
A VFD (Vacuum Fluorescent Display) control panel offers easy programming and activation of the AirPod System. Programming the three AirPod pressure presets is just like setting the radio station presets in your car. Simply set the first preset to the desired inflation settings using the manual inflate/deflate buttons, then hold the preset button number one for six seconds. Repeat this step for the two remaining presets--RideTech recommends lowest ride height for Preset 1, normal height for Preset 2, and fully extended height for Preset 3.
Once the system is programmed, the display gives you push-button control of your air suspension system. To choose one of your preset settings, simply press one of the three buttons at the bottom of the display. You can view the settings for each preset in numeric and/or bar graph form by pressing and holding the button at the top of the display at any time. The display also allows you to make easy adjustments to pressure settings, compression trigger (the pressure at which the compressor turns on), inflation speed, and display light intensity.
AirPod Advantage Three: Clean Looks
Installation is clean, and the AirPod System's look is even cleaner because the amount of wiring and plumbing is drastically reduced compared to standard air suspension setups. The AirPod comes with a great-looking cover to hide all of the components and maintain a sleek appearance.
The overall size of the AirPod System also keeps your ride looking neat. There are two tank size options--three or five gallons--to ensure that the AirPod is right for your project. The three gallon AirPod System has a footprint of only 240 square inches (12 x 20 inches); the five gallon version is slightly larger at 12 x 32 inches. Either system mounts inside your trunk without using up all your valuable space.
